DILEMASTRONAUTA y La Tripulación Cósmica - led by Combo Chimbita-drummer Andres Jimenez - present their second band offering featuring a new line up that adds Carlos Rienzo, the sole millo flute player in the US. “To me there’s no one like him in the city,” says Jiménez. “It really wouldn’t be what it is without Carlos,” who sings, plays percussion, gaita and the millo, a high-pitched wind instrument, “a flute that is meant to play Colombian music and we’re putting it in a different context. To me it’s one of the most unique lineups that I work with.” The group also features NY-Bogotá mainstays Ricardo Gallo (Los ALiENs) on synthesizers and Juan Ospina (M.A.K.U. Soundsystem) on bass.
“This project was born out of a musical residency down in Bushwick at this place called Sleepwalk. I wanted to understand and play with the millo flute. I was interested in the way it’s played and how it would sound in a non-traditional context. So we had the luck to have Carlos Rienzo, and we were trying to find common grounds as to how to interact musically. We started exploring these traditional songs and that led to the creation of two original songs. But these songs and the way we played it really was born from playing it live in front of people."
To document and celebrate the group's new line up, DILEMASTRONAUTA y La Tripulación Cósmica are releasing a limited edition 12-inch vinyl EP comprising three traditionals and two original songs, featuring cover art by Bogotano artist Mateo Rivano. “Most times we have to look back to different sources to understand how to move forward. And in this case, I hope that this we’re doing is some kind of reference as to what I was about musically and how I feel about the world,” says DILEMASTRONAUTA, who sees the EP as “a diary for my daughter.”
